1. Tropisms are directional movements or growth response of a plant to the stimulus. In nastic movements, the response of the plant is non-directional. An example of tropism is thigmotropism, which is a growth response to the touch stimulus.
2. Nyctinasty is the nastic movement of plant parts such as leaves and petals in response to darkness.
3. Thigmonasty is a form of nastic movement (of a plant or a fungus) as a response to touch or vibration.

The events occurring in the light reaction of the photosynthesis are: Absorption of sunlight by the chlorophyll and release of the electron to the carriers. Photolysis of water to provide the electron to the chlorophyll. The release of molecular oxygen due to the photolysis of water.
